Meatless Monday: Vegan Vegetarian 4th of July Recipes

Image credit Viri G

Enjoy the long holiday weekend with these vegan vegetarian 4th of July recipes. Share the latest trend in beverages with your guests; shrubs. They’re alcohol-free drinks prepared with fruit and vinegar. Just like a fine wine, they grow better with age. One refreshing jug could be drawn from for nearly a month. You could almost compare it to homemade ginger ale. And if you’re not into sugar, you could easily substitute stevia or agave. Everything else on the vegan vegetarian 4th of July recipes menu is a grill item, even the Sourdough Sandwich AND the Pound Cake Trifle! Happy Independence Day!

NOTE: If you’ll also be cooking meats on the grill, take care to either have a separate grill or section of the grill for vegan vegetarian items, or carefully clean the grill between meats and vegan vegetarian items. If barbecuing kabobs on wooden skewers, soak the skewers in water at least 30 minutes before grilling.
